If the countrys name ends with the vowel -e, its feminine: There are a few exceptions to this rule: le Mexique (Mexico), le Cambodge (Cambodia), le Mozambique (Mozambique), le Zimbabwe (Zimbabwe). Nouns that end in a vowel plus L, N, or T usually become feminine by doubling the consonant before adding E. Ending:en>enneNoun:le gardien(guard)Masculine singularle gardienFeminine singularla gardienneMasculine pluralles gardiensFeminine pluralles gardiennes, Ending:el>elleNoun:le colonel(colonel)Masculine singularle colonelFeminine singularla colonelleMasculine pluralles colonelsFeminine pluralles colonelles.
